Dreamcast variants
Two special edition Dreamcasts were produced for the game, a red 'Claire ver.' and a blue 'S.T.A.R.S. ver.'. These were available as prizes in a contest.
Manhua
- Main article: BIOHAZARD CODE:Veronica (manhua) A sixteen-part manhua adaptation was published by the Hong Konger studio, Tinhangse. This followed an earlier original manhua series which tied the events of Resident Evil 2 and Resident Evil 3: Nemesis to the game. In addition to a lot of hand-to-hand combat (Chris, Claire, and Steve each take out monsters using unarmed attacks) and some rather ridiculous shots (Claire kills multiple zombies with a single bullet), Chris is portrayed as being left-handed. The manhua also features a "flashback" of the first game, to recount Chris' last encounter with Wesker.An English translation was also published by WildStorm.
Promotional merchandise
In the lead-up to the game's release, Capcom entered an arrangement with the Japanese retailer Lawson to sell exclusive toys, with the BIOHAZARD CODE: Veronica Original Choker being one such product.
Arcade spinoff
This game's events on Rockfort Island are retold in the arcade-styled game Resident Evil Survivor 2 CODE: Veronica; the events in this installments are nightmares Claire has after Rockfort Island
